<p>For admission into Sawai Man Singh College for M.Sc Medical Biochemistry, first you need to meet eligibility criteria. A candidate seeking MSc admission in Med biochemistry need to complete a Bachelor degree in MBBS/BDS/BSc from a recognised university. Admission to MSc Med biochemistry is based on scores in the Rajasthan Centralized Admission test. Later, Rajasthan University of Health Science (RUHS) conducts Counselling, you need to apply it and if you have good score then you will definitely get admission.&nbsp;</p>

<p><strong>BSc admissions at CSJM University</strong> are merit-based. Hence, no entrance exam is required. The university shortlists candidates based on their merit in Class 12. They must also meet the basic eligibility criteria specified by the univeristy and present the necessary documents supporting their eligibility. Shortlisted candidates are called for counselling and document verification.</p>

Most universities require your passing degree or provisional certificate to gain admission in M.Sc. which means that you have to clear all backlogs before you can qualify for admission in M.Sc. However, under special circumstances a few universities do grant admission into their M.Sc course provided all backlogs are cleared on time.

The usual eligibility to pursue M.Sc. In clinical psychology is mentioned below:
- Bachelors degree with minimum 50% marks from any recognised University following 10+2+3 course pattern. - Some reputed colleges and universities conduct entrance examination for admission to the M.Sc. Degree courses. This may vary as per different institutes.
